Plastic baths, commonly called acrylic baths, are created using vacuum-formed acrylic sheets. As a result, acrylic baths are more budget-friendly, lighter, and available in diverse designs compared to stainless steel baths. Unfortunately, they are not as resilient as metal baths, making them prone to chips, cracks, and other damage. Sometimes the surface of your acrylic bath can be worn down due to using abrasive cleaning products like bleach and Cif. This results in a dull surface that attracts dirt, making your bath harder to maintain. We can repair this easily by resurfacing your bath for you. Did you ever wonder how many shades of white there are? From bright white to off-white, every bath and shower tray has a unique shade. One of the most important steps in repairing a bath is colour matching a new enamel paint for the repair to match your bath. Our technicians are experts in colour matching, having honed their skills over years of experience. Because bath surfaces can fade or change over time, an exact colour match requires expert mixing. Custom tinting ensures that the repaired area blends perfectly with your bath’s original shade.

When our technician arrives to do your acrylic bath repair, he will fill the damage with our special filler and apply a special bonder to it. Next, the technician precisely colour-matches the enamel using tinting techniques and applies it with a fine spray gun. 1. A professional assessment of your bath’s damage is done before providing a transparent quote.
2. Upon acceptance, our technician will promptly schedule and prepare for the repair. 3. He'll clean the area and fill in any holes, cracks, scratches, etc. He'll smooth these out so the surface is smooth. 4. A specialized bonding solution is applied to reinforce the repair and ensure seamless adhesion. 5. He will then colour match the new enamel paint to the surface of your bath. He'll then spray this on using a fine spray gun. 6. Once completed, the repair requires 24 hours to fully harden before the bath can be used. 7.
